Our proven track record in embedded development services offers our clients a mix of low risk, high value and a time to market solution. Our team acts as a catalyst for our clients to deliver their embedded products on time, with exceptional quality. Our experts have in-depth understanding about various operating system architectures that are required for embedded software development. The team is equally exposed to the various hardware platforms and is therefore aware of the intricacies of hardware programming. More importantly, our team has a greater exposure towards developing embedded software solutions for timing and resource constrained environment and for mission critical applications.
Our capabilities in a nutshell
Developing Board Support Packages Embedded OS and Application Porting Embedded Application Development Developing mission critical embedded software Developing Real Time Embedded Applications Exposure to industry standard RTOS’s Exposure to various hardware architecturesOur Expertise
OS Porting We have a great exposure towards porting the following operating systems
WinCE Embedded Linux uCOS eCosOur expertise primarily lies in closely working with our customers to understand their needs based on which perform BSP up gradation to the existing reference BSP’s and add more features to it which are otherwise not present in the reference solution.
Windows CE Services
Our exposure in Windows CE development empowers our customers to meet their time to market goals without compromising with the quality of the product which is based on WiCE operating system. Our team has great expertise in turnkey development using WinCE Operating System in the following areas:
WinCE BSP Development
We have a great expertise in fine tuning the WinCE reference BSP to meet the needs of our customers. Our alliance partnerships with various semiconductor companies has empowered us to get an easier access of reference WinCE BSP for specific platforms which helps us fine tuning the same as per our customers’ requirements within a stipulated time.
Our team has worked on developing WinCE BSP for various architectures including
Freescale i.MX27 Freescale i.MX31 Atmel AT91SAM9263Embedded Linux Services
We can help you to introduce Linux in your embedded products. We have great expertise in Linux kernel porting and device driver development, integration of open-source components and system building.
Our exposure in Embedded Linux empowers our customers to meet their time to market goals without compromising with the quality of the product based on Embedded Linux operating system. We have developed many turnkey solutions in Embedded Linux in the past have successfully deployed it various fields including AMR, hospitality and logistics devices, communication devices and the likes.
Embedded Linux BSP Development
To expedite and successfully deliver our Embedded Linux BSP development services, we work closely with semiconductor companies to add features to the various BSP’s that are available for a specific processor.
Our team has worked on developing Embedded Linux BSP for various architectures including
reescale i.MX27 Freescale i.MX31 Atmel AT91SAM9263 Atmel AT91SAM9260 NXP LPC 2294Device Driver Development
We have developed various embedded device drivers in past across various peripherals on multiple SoCs based on ARM architecture. The various device controllers for which the drivers have been developed are listed below
WLAN - 802.11a/b/g with WEP and WPA Ethernet SDIO SD/MMC ATA SATA LCD VGA GSM/GPRS I2C, I2S Bus SPI, Serial Port, Touch USB Host / Device IrDA Printer Camera Audio Bio-metric SensorEmbedded Application Development
In addition to the board bringup activities, we have enough expertise to build a platform to support embedded application development. We have successfully ported JAVA , QT on embedded Linux and Windows .Net on WinCE 5.0 and 6.0 embedded operating systems.
We have developed various embedded applications and have expertise in the following areas
Windows .NET for Embedded Embedded JAVA QT